It follows a series of needlessly complicated segments that establish an overly complex plot in which young bruiser Tyler (Nicholas Tse) teams up with older pal Jack (Wu Bai), a butcher and former hitman, to take on a group of South American mercenaries. For some reason, both have pregnant partners they need to protect. While the story can be tricky to follow, the action never is – it is filmed and edited with a level of visual coherence that few other films manage to muster, while never sacrificing on scale, speed, ingenuity or flair.
